ensp中client的功能
时间: 2024-04-21 20:27:16 浏览: 367
ENSP(Enterprise Network Simulation Platform)中的Client是指客户端,它的主要功能是连接到ENSP的服务器端,以实现网络拓扑图的创建、配置、模拟和监控等操作。具体来说,ENSP的Client可以完成以下功能:
1. 创建和配置网络拓扑图:通过ENSP的Client,用户可以创建和配置各种网络设备,如交换机、路由器、防火墙等,并将它们连接起来,形成一个完整的网络拓扑图。
2. 模拟网络运行环境:通过ENSP的Client,用户可以模拟网络设备的运行环境,例如,可以设置设备的IP地址、路由协议、ACL等参数,以模拟真实网络的运行情况。
3. 监控网络状态:ENSP的Client可以实时监控网络设备的状态,例如,可以查看设备的接口状态、流量情况、CPU和内存利用率等信息,以便及时发现和解决网络故障。
4. 分析网络性能:ENSP的Client可以帮助用户分析网络的性能,例如,可以对网络流量进行抓包和分析,以发现网络瓶颈和性能问题。
总之,ENSP的Client是一个非常强大的网络仿真工具,可以帮助用户快速构建和测试各种网络拓扑图,提高网络设计和运维效率。
相关问题
ensp中防火墙ssl的配置代码
### 回答1:
以下为防火墙SSL配置代码示例:
1. 配置证书和密钥
```
config firewall ssl-ssh-profile
edit "ssl_profile_name"
set type server
set cert "ssl_certificate_name"
set key "ssl_key_name"
next
end
```
2. 配置SSL代理
```
config firewall ssl-ssh-profile
edit "ssl_profile_name"
set type server
set cert "ssl_certificate_name"
set key "ssl_key_name"
next
end
config firewall ssl-ssh-proxy
edit "ssl_proxy_name"
set ssl-ssh-profile "ssl_profile_name"
set server-cert-validation disable
set ssl-min-version tls1.2
set ssl-max-version tls1.3
set cipher-suites "AES256-SHA256:AES256-GCM-SHA384"
set tls-proto-list "TLSv1.2:TLSv1.3"
set ssl-server-algorithm "ECDHE-RSA-AES256-GCM-SHA384"
set ssl-client-authentication enable
set ssl-client-verification enable
set ssl-client-root-ca "ca_certificate_name"
next
end
```
3. 配置SSL VPN
```
config vpn ssl settings
set idle-timeout 3600
set auth-timeout 3600
set tunnel-ip-pools "ssl_vpn_pool"
set ssl-max-version tls1.3
set ssl-cipher "AES256-SHA256"
set ssl-sslv2 disable
set ssl-sslv3 disable
set ssl-tls11 enable
set ssl-tls12 enable
set ssl-tls13 enable
set ssl-dh-group "group14"
set auth-portal-redirect disable
set auth-portal-fqdn "vpn.example.com"
set auth-portal-custom-text "Welcome to the VPN portal"
set auth-portal-logout-url "https://www.example.com/logout"
set auth-portal-login-url "https://www.example.com/login"
set auth-portal-authentication disable
set auth-portal-authentication-redirect enable
set auth-portal-authentication-fqdn "auth.example.com"
set auth-portal-authentication-custom-text "Please enter your credentials"
set auth-portal-authentication-method "LDAP"
set auth-portal-authentication-ldap-server "ldap.example.com"
set auth-portal-authentication-ldap-port 636
set auth-portal-authentication-ldap-ssl enable
set auth-portal-authentication-ldap-base-dn "dc=example,dc=com"
set auth-portal-authentication-ldap-username-attribute "uid"
set auth-portal-authentication-ldap-group-membership-attribute "memberOf"
set auth-portal-authentication-ldap-group-search-base-dn "ou=Groups,dc=example,dc=com"
set auth-portal-authentication-ldap-group-search-filter "(objectClass=groupOfNames)"
set auth-portal-authentication-ldap-group-search-attribute "cn"
end
```
### 回答2:
ensp中防火墙ssl的配置代码如下:
1. 为防火墙生成自签名SSL证书:
ssl genrsa 2048
ssl req –new –x509 –key private.key –out certificate.crt –days 365
注:上述命令中的private.key是私钥文件名,certificate.crt是生成的SSL证书文件名,days 365表示证书有效期为365天。
2. 配置防火墙的SSL选项:
ssl config {enable | disable}
注:上述命令用于启用或禁用SSL功能。
3. 配置防火墙的SSL证书:
ssl certhttps://www.example.com/ssl.crt
注:上述命令中的ssl.crt代表从服务器获取的SSL证书文件。
4. 配置防火墙的SSL私钥:
ssl key private.key
注:上述命令中的private.key代表服务器上的私钥文件。
5. 配置防火墙的SSL密码:
ssl password enable
ssl passwordecho password
注:上述命令中的password代表SSL密码。
6. 配置防火墙的SSL端口:
ssl port port-num
注:上述命令中的port-num代表要使用的SSL端口号。
7. 配置防火墙的SSL协议版本:
ssl protocol {sslv3 | tls1.0 | tls1.1 | tls1.2}
注:上述命令用于指定防火墙使用的SSL协议版本。
8. 配置防火墙的SSL会话超时时间:
ssl timeout timeout-value
注:上述命令中的timeout-value代表SSL会话的超时时间。
以上是ensp中防火墙SSL的基本配置代码,根据实际需求可以进行相应调整和扩展。
在ensp中实现文本要求,其中YY为25
要在ENSP(Enterprise Network Simulation Platform)中实现给定的任务,以下是详细的步骤:
### 1. 搭建网络结构并配置IP地址
- **设备命名**:
- 路由器:`RT_XXX_01`, `RT_XXX_02`, `RT_XXX_03`(XXX为个人姓名缩写)
- FTP服务器:`FTP_XXX_Server`
- FTP客户端:`FTP_XXX_Client`
- **IP地址配置**:
- 使用学号末尾两位数25进行配置。
- 示例:假设学号为12345,则1YY = 125。
- 具体IP地址分配需根据网络拓扑图中的要求进行。
### 2. 配置DNS服务器和Web服务器
- **DNS服务器**:
- IP地址:根据图1配置。
- 配置域名解析:`www.cqipc_XXX.edu.cn`指向Web服务器的IP地址。
- **Web服务器**:
- IP地址:根据图1配置。
- 开通Web服务。
### 3. 划分VLAN并配置单臂路由
- **VLAN划分**:
- 在交换机2 (`S_XXX_02`) 上将PC1和DNS服务器分别划入VLAN 10和VLAN 20。
- **单臂路由配置**:
- 在路由器1 (`RT_XXX_01`) 上配置单臂路由,使PC1与DNS服务器能够通信。
### 4. 配置链路聚合
- **链路聚合**:
- 在路由器2 (`RT_XXX_02`) 和路由器3 (`RT_XXX_03`) 之间配置链路聚合,采用LACP模式,主备比例2:1。
### 5. 配置DHCP服务器
- **DHCP服务器**:
- 在路由器3 (`RT_XXX_03`) 上配置DHCP服务器,使用全局地址池配置方式。
- 使PC2能从该DHCP服务器上动态获得IP地址。
### 6. 配置FTP服务器
- **FTP服务器**:
- 配置用户名:`user_XXX`
- 密码:`cqipc_XXX`
- 实现FTP客户端能访问FTP服务器的功能。
- Web客户端能通过域名`www.cqipc_XXX.edu.cn`访问到Web服务器。
### 示例配置命令
以下是一些关键配置命令的示例:
#### 路由器命名
```bash
RT_XXX_01(config)# hostname RT_XXX_01
RT_XXX_02(config)# hostname RT_XXX_02
RT_XXX_03(config)# hostname RT_XXX_03
```
#### 单臂路由配置
```bash
RT_XXX_01(config)# interface GigabitEthernet 0/0/1
RT_XXX_01(config-if)# no shutdown
RT_XXX_01(config-if)# ip address 192.168.1.1 255.255.255.0
RT_XXX_01(config-if)# exit
RT_XXX_01(config)# interface GigabitEthernet 0/0/2
RT_XXX_01(config-if)# no shutdown
RT_XXX_01(config-if)# ip address 192.168.2.1 255.255.255.0
RT_XXX_01(config-if)# exit
RT_XXX_01(config)# interface GigabitEthernet 0/0/3
RT_XXX_01(config-if)# no shutdown
RT_XXX_01(config-if)# encapsulation dot1Q 10
RT_XXX_01(config-subif)# ip address 192.168.10.1 255.255.255.0
RT_XXX_01(config-subif)# exit
RT_XXX_01(config-if)# encapsulation dot1Q 20
RT_XXX_01(config-subif)# ip address 192.168.20.1 255.255.255.0
```
#### DHCP服务器配置
```bash
RT_XXX_03(config)# ip dhcp pool LAN
RT_XXX_03(dhcp-config)# network 192.168.3.0 255.255.255.0
RT_XXX_03(dhcp-config)# default-router 192.168.3.1
RT_XXX_03(dhcp-config)# dns-server 192.168.2.2
RT_XXX_03(dhcp-config)# exit
```
#### FTP服务器配置
```bash
FTP_XXX_Server(config)# ip address 192.168.1.100 255.255.255.0
FTP_XXX_Server(config)# username user_XXX password cqipc_XXX
FTP_XXX_Server(config)# ftp server enable
FTP_XXX_Server(config)# access-list 1 permit 192.168.1.0 0.0.0.255
FTP_XXX_Server(config)# ftp server passive-mode
FTP_XXX_Server(config)# ftp server root-directory /FTP_XXX
```
### 总结
以上步骤涵盖了在ENSP中实现给定任务的所有必要配置。请根据具体的网络拓扑图和个人需求进行详细配置。如有任何疑问或需要进一步的帮助,请随时提问。
阅读全文